Band: Marc Rizzo Marc Rizzo, an American guitar player who could easily be one of the world’s best guitar players, but also one of the most underrated one. Some of you might know him from “Ill Niño”. But the biggest part of his army of fans comes from his guitar work with Soulfly and Cavalera Conspiracy. Busy as he is, he still finds the time to do other projects. He already has 2 instructional dvd’s released, 2 solo albums and now a third one called “Legionnaire”. Witch contains 11 songs of brain melting shred metal. You can compare it to Satriani or Yngwie Malmsteen but it still has a distinct sound en vibe. One time it has a flamenco feeling to it and another time it’s totally jazz (but all in a metal jacket). It’s impressive, it’s a long and very inspiring. It feels like a journey with heights and depths, calmer and ruff parts, …. all well performed. The one thing that could be a downside for people is that this kind of albums lack vocals. 95/100 Jeroen. |
